寒区冷补沥青液的制备及优化设计  被引量:1

Preparation and Optimization Design of Cold Patch Asphalt in Cold Regions

摘  要:目的 研究寒区冷补沥青液的制备,解决寒区沥青路面坑槽病害难以快速、高质量修补的问题。方法 采用3#航空煤油、100#溶剂油作为稀释剂,单组分湿固化添加剂、单组分树脂类添加剂以及抗剥落剂LB-6176作为添加剂,制备适合寒区使用的冷补沥青液;采用正交试验对冷补液的配方进行优化,提出寒区冷补液性能建议技术要求。结果 冷补液黏度受到稀释剂和添加剂掺量的影响程度最大,抗剥落剂和添加剂决定了黏附性和1~3d内挥发性的好坏,流动性能随添加剂掺量的增加而降低,且影响趋势相似。结论 冷补液的配比为:沥青100%(外掺质量分数),稀释剂40%,添加剂12%,抗剥落剂0.2%;建议冷补液常温表观黏度不超过20 Pa·s、黏附性等级不小于4级、流动时间小于180 s、1 d的损失率不小于0.7%、3 d损失率不小于1.0%。The preparation of cold patch asphalt in cold regions was studied.The problem that asphalt pavement potholes in cold regions are difficult to be repaired quickly and with high quality has been solved.3#aviation kerosene and 100#solvent oil were used as diluents,and one-component wet-curing additive,one-component resin additive and anti stripping agent LB-6176 are used as additives.The formula of cold rehydration solution was optimized by orthogonal test,and the technical requirements for cold rehydration performance were proposed.The viscosity of cold rehydration solution is most affected by the amount of diluent and additive.The anti stripping agent and additive determine the adhesiveness and volatility within 1~3 days.The flow performance decreases with the increase of the amount of additive,and the influence trend is similar.The proportion of cold patch asphalt is:asphalt 100%(added mass fraction),diluent 40%,additive 12%,anti stripping agent 0.2%.It is recommended that the apparent viscosity of cold patch asphalt at room temperature should not exceed 20 Pa·s,the adhesion grade should not be less than Grade 4,the flow time should be less than 180 s,the loss rate of 1d should not be less than 0.7%,and the loss rate of 3 d should not be less than 1.0%.
